#c6452d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6452d is composed of 77.6% red, 27.1%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.2% magenta, 77.3%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 9.4 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 47.6%. #c6452d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a5a with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c6452d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c6452d has RGB values of R:198, G:69,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.77,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12993837.

Shades and Tints of #c6452d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6452d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7878 is the less saturated color, while #eb2b08 is the most saturated one.
